Product Description

​The GE Fanuc IC200MDL750D VersaMax Discrete Output Module is a high-density digital output module designed to provide reliable and efficient control of various output devices in industrial automation systems. With 32 discrete output points organized into two groups of 16, this module is optimized for controlling devices such as relays, solenoids, and other digital actuators. It integrates seamlessly with the VersaMax I/O system, ensuring optimal performance in machine control, process control, and other industrial applications.​

Product Specifications

Below is a detailed table of the technical specifications for the IC200MDL750D module:​

Specification Details
Manufacturer GE Fanuc
Series VersaMax I/O
Part Number IC200MDL750D
Module Type Discrete Output Module
Number of Outputs 32 (2 groups of 16)
Output Voltage Range 10.2 to 30 VDC (Nominal: 12/24 VDC)
Output Current per Channel 0.5 A (Resistive load)
Inrush Current 2.0 A maximum for 100 ms
Output Voltage Drop 0.3 V maximum
Output Leakage Current 0.5 mA at 30 VDC maximum
Response Time (ON/OFF) ON: 0.2 ms max; OFF: 1.0 ms max
Backplane Current Consumption 90 mA maximum at 5 VDC
External Power Supply 10.2 to 30 VDC (Nominal: 12/24 VDC)
Isolation User input to logic and frame ground: 250 VAC continuous; 1500 VAC for 1 minute
LED Indicators Individual channel LEDs, OK LED, FLD PWR LED
Operating Temperature 0°C to 60°C (32°F to 140°F)
Storage Temperature -40°C to 85°C (-40°F to 185°F)
Humidity 5% to 95% RH, non-condensing
Dimensions (W x H x D) 110 × 66.8 × 50 mm
Weight 0.132 kg
Certifications CE Marked, UL Listed, RoHS Compliant, CSA Certified

Product Applications

The IC200MDL750D module is versatile and suitable for a wide range of industrial applications, including:​

  • Manufacturing Automation: Controls machinery and production lines, ensuring precise operation of actuators and relays.​

  • Process Control Systems: Manages processes in industries such as chemical, pharmaceutical, and food processing, where accurate output control is critical.​

  • Material Handling: Operates conveyors, sorters, and other material handling equipment, facilitating efficient movement of goods.​

  • Energy Management: Integrates with systems to control lighting, HVAC, and other energy-consuming devices for optimized energy usage.​

  • Water and Wastewater Treatment: Controls pumps, valves, and other equipment essential for treatment processes.​

Frequently Asked Questions (FAQ)

  1. What is the maximum output current per channel for the IC200MDL750D module?

    • The IC200MDL750D module can handle up to 0.5 A per channel with a resistive load.

  2. Can the IC200MDL750D module be used with a 12 VDC power supply?

    • Yes, the module operates within a voltage range of 10.2 to 30 VDC, which includes both 12 VDC and 24 VDC nominal systems.

  3. What types of devices can the IC200MDL750D control?

    • The module is designed to control digital actuators such as relays, solenoids, motors, and other similar devices in industrial applications.

  4. Does the IC200MDL750D module offer isolation?

    • Yes, the module provides 250 VAC continuous isolation between the user input and logic/frame ground, ensuring safety in industrial environments.

  5. Are there any indicator LEDs on the module?

    • Yes, the module features individual LEDs for each output channel, along with an “OK” LED to show the health of the module and an “FLD PWR” LED to indicate the presence of field power.

  6. What is the response time of the outputs on the IC200MDL750D?

    • The ON response time is 0.2 ms maximum, and the OFF response time is 1.0 ms maximum, ensuring quick switching.

  7. Can the IC200MDL750D module be used in high-temperature environments?

    • Yes, the module is rated for operation in temperatures ranging from 0°C to 60°C (32°F to 140°F).

  8. Is the IC200MDL750D compatible with other VersaMax modules?

    • Yes, this module is fully compatible with the VersaMax I/O system and can be integrated seamlessly into existing VersaMax setups.

  9. What are the dimensions and weight of the IC200MDL750D module?

    • The module measures 110 × 66.8 × 50 mm and weighs 0.132 kg.

  10. Does the IC200MDL750D module have certifications for safety and compliance?

    • Yes, the module is CE marked, UL listed, CSA certified, and RoHS compliant, ensuring it meets global safety and environmental standards.
